Nameko Mushrooms 1 lb bag / box each
Bright orange nameko mushrooms are a popular Japanese mushroom variety with a mild, earthy flavor and an aroma similar to cashews.
Their caps display a distinctive glossy sheen due to a naturally occurring gelatin coating.

Also known as butterscotch mushrooms in the United States

Soft, silky texture (when rehydrated) and a sweet, nutty flavor

Cap ranges from 1 to 3 inches in diameter, while stems are 2 to 3 inches long

Suggested Uses :

Add to miso soup, a common practice in Japan

Delicious in stir-fries and even risotto, in which the mushrooms help thicken and improve the dish’s texture

After rehydrating, strain and save the flavorful, umami-packed liquid to add to soups, stocks and sauces

Pair with noodles, seafood and chicken

Roast or grill to enhance their nutty aroma and umami flavor

Company Profile




Diana and David Moore met at a luxury hotel in the late 1980s. She was a concierge and he was a food and beverage director. They soon realized they had a shared love and curiosity for nature and began hiking and foraging together on the weekends. Following that decade in the service industry, the now husband-and-wife team founded Woodland Foods with the goal of connecting others to the same dedication to service and passion for nature and adventure that initially drew them together.
Since our very first shipment of Chanterelle Mushrooms over three decades ago, to the more than 1,600 unique ingredients we offer today, our mission at Woodland Foods has always focused on obtaining the uncommon, pushing the limits of culinary innovation, and ethically sourcing the same ancient foods that have sustained global populations for millennia.
From quinoa fields in the Andes Mountains of Peru to red rice from the lush fields of Bhutan, we have traveled the world in search of the next remarkable ingredient - and the next great story.
Over the past 30 years, we have grown from a small team working out of an apartment to a workforce of over 300 in 475,000 square feet. Our three facilities house a new fine-mesh pulverizer and state-of-the-art sterilization equipment, making these unusual ingredients market-ready.
